hallo. Not much of an update as I've just been using it day in day out. Still going without any problems which is always good

Had a sunny few days so decided to do a bit of undersealing and fit my mudflaps at the same time. Typical Scotland though as soon as I had the car jacked up in the air it started pishing down and blowing a gale. Wasn't letting the wind or rain dampen my spirits though so cracked on and made a wee tent out of some plastic sheeting for a bit of shelter lol!

Up in the air


Back bumper off to inspect for rust, very clean!


My wee shelter


Was starting to go flaky around the spare wheel well and rear chassis legs so I wire brushed that clean and applied the underseal (horrible stuff). The rest of the car seems in good order underneath although I suspect the drivers seat mount will need attention sooner rather than later, bar that it's all good! Never got any pics but who wants to see the grubby underneath of my car anyway!

I decided to swap the Escort Cossie wheels over from my Orion as it's sitting in the garage and I don't want the tires to get flat spots + I fancied a change anyway for the time being.


With my pals 2.0 Corsa


Painted the rocker cover electric Orange with black/polished details when I did the cage but I don't think I ever included a photo. I also put an HT lead cover on it to smarten it up.

Thanks mate. They're honestly more or less the exact same up to a point. The escort is slightly quicker through the gears up to about 120 then the corsa will creep past (pvt road as usual )

It's a shame the zetec conversions aren't as common compared to the redtops in wee vauxhalls as they're a really worthwhile + cheap alternative.
